A place to stay in Castelrotto
Hotel Alpenroyal is a four-star hotel in Castelrotto, a small Alpine town in South Tyrol. The property runs two swimming pools, a spa and wellness center, a fitness center, and two on-site restaurants — enough to keep guests occupied without leaving the building. Nine room types cover everything from a single room to a two-bedroom apartment, and there is free parking on-site. The hotel has earned a 4.7/5 guest rating across 304 reviews, with cleanliness, comfort, and staff singled out as particular strengths.

Two pools and a sun deck
The hotel runs two swimming pools alongside a terrace, sun deck, and garden. Outdoor furniture and balconies on many room types mean guests can get the mountain air without going far.
Spa and wellness center
The spa and wellness center is a proper facility, not a token add-on. Guests also have access to a fitness center and a hot tub, making it a reasonable base for a longer, rest-focused stay.
Two restaurants and a bar
With two restaurants and a bar on-site, dining does not require a car or a walk into town. Breakfast has been specifically highlighted by guests as a strength of the stay.
Rooms with landmark views
Several room categories include balconies and landmark or panorama views. The Double Room with Panorama View and the Suite with Balcony are the clearest options if the mountain outlook matters to you.
Ski facilities on-site
The hotel has a ski pass vendor and ski storage — a practical pair for guests arriving to ski. Castelrotto sits within reach of the Dolomites ski area, and having both services in-house saves time on travel days.

Where exactly is Hotel Alpenroyal?
The hotel is in Castelrotto, a town in South Tyrol, Italy, close to the Dolomites. It is well-positioned for both skiing in winter and Alpine walking in the warmer months.
Is there free parking at the hotel?
Yes, free parking is available on-site. You do not need to arrange or pay for parking separately.
How many pools does the hotel have?
There are two swimming pools. The hotel also has a sun deck, terrace, outdoor furniture, and a garden area alongside them.
What dining options are available on-site?
The hotel has two restaurants and a bar. Breakfast is included in many stays and has been well-regarded by guests. Room service is also available.
What room types are available for families?
The Family Suite has one king bed and two bunk beds. The Two-Bedroom Apartment and the One-Bedroom Apartment also work well for families needing more space or a self-contained setup.
Is the hotel suitable for skiers?
Yes. The hotel has a ski pass vendor and ski storage on-site, which covers the two most practical needs for a ski trip. Castelrotto is located in the Dolomites skiing area.
